/****************************************************************************\
|
| Basic definitions for US915 (always in scope)
|
\****************************************************************************/
// Frequency plan for US 915MHz ISM band
// data rates
enum _dr_us915_t {
US915_DR_SF10 = 0,
US915_DR_SF9,
US915_DR_SF8,
US915_DR_SF7,
US915_DR_SF8C,
US915_DR_NONE,
// Devices "behind a router" (and upper half of DR list):
US915_DR_SF12CR = 8,
US915_DR_SF11CR,
US915_DR_SF10CR,
US915_DR_SF9CR,
US915_DR_SF8CR,
US915_DR_SF7CR
};
// Default frequency plan for US 915MHz
enum {
US915_125kHz_UPFBASE = 902300000,
US915_125kHz_UPFSTEP = 200000,
US915_500kHz_UPFBASE = 903000000,
US915_500kHz_UPFSTEP = 1600000,
US915_500kHz_DNFBASE = 923300000,
US915_500kHz_DNFSTEP = 600000
};
enum {
US915_FREQ_MIN = 902000000,
US915_FREQ_MAX = 928000000
};
enum {
US915_TX_MAX_DBM = 30 // 30 dBm (but not EIRP): assumes we're
// on an 64-channel bandplan. See code
// that computes tx power.
};
enum {
US915_LinkAdrReq_POW_MAX_1_0_2 = 0xA,
US915_LinkAdrReq_POW_MAX_1_0_3 = 0xE,
};
enum { DR_PAGE_US915 = 0x10 * (LMIC_REGION_us915 - 1) };
enum { US915_LMIC_REGION_EIRP = 0 }; // region doesn't use EIRP, uses tx power
#endif /* _lorabase_us915_h_ */
